Abstract
This document defines a mechanism to route RFC 822 using the OSI Directory. The basic mechanisms are being developed for routing X.400. These offer a number of benefits relative to the the current mechanisms available for RFC 822 routing. The prime goal of this specification is to provide integrated routing management for sites using both RFC 822 and X.400.
